Understanding Chemical Formulas: The Language of Chemistry

Chemical equations are the fundamental building blocks of chemistry. They provide a concise and unambiguous way to communicate the structure of chemical substances. Just as codes allow us to exchange information, chemical formulas serve as a universal medium for chemists around the world.

Each symbol in a chemical formula represents a specific atom, and the indices indicate the amount of each element present. By analyzing these formulas, we can extract valuable information about the properties of chemical substances.
